Inverter argon arc welding machine
Argon arc welding is a welding method in which the welding arc is generated between a tungsten electrode and a base material with very stable physical properties. Its full name is non melting inert gas shielded welding. Due to the widespread use of argon gas as a shielding gas, it is also referred to as argon arc welding. An obvious characteristic of argon arc welding is that its arc can be AC or DC. During the welding process, wire filling is not necessary or can be done manually or automatically.
Argon arc welding is widely used for welding with high requirements for welds, such as pressure pipelines, machinery, metal furniture, and sports equipment. In many specific fields such as nuclear power and aerospace, argon arc welding is also used. Argon arc welding machines are usually classified by function into DC argon arc welding and AC-DC argon arc welding.
DC argon arc welding
